Ingredients You’ll Need

Simple, fresh ingredients make all the difference in this recipe, each playing a crucial role in elevating the flavor and texture. From the rich, buttery croissants to the perfectly seasoned beef, every element works together to create an unforgettable burger.

  • 1 pound Ground Beef (80/20): The fat content ensures juicy and flavorful smash patties that stay tender.
  • 1 teaspoon Salt: Enhances all the natural flavors in the beef for that perfect seasoning.
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per (freshly ground black): Adds a subtle heat and aroma that complements the beef’s richness.
  • 4 Croissants: Flaky and multi-layered, offering a light buttery crunch instead of a traditional bun.
  • 2 tablespoons Butter: Used for toasting the croissants to golden perfection and adding extra flavor.
  • 1 cup Lettuce: Fresh crunch to balance the burger’s richness.
  • 1 medium Tomato (sliced): Adds juicy sweetness and color contrast.
  • 4 slices Cheese (your favorite type): Melts beautifully over the patties to add creaminess.
  • Condiments to taste: Ketchup, mustard, or aioli bring that final layer of flavor and personality.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

If you have any leftovers from your Ultimate Crispy Croissant Smash Burgers Recipe in 5 Easy Steps Recipe, wrap them tightly in foil or store in an airtight container. They will keep well in the refrigerator for up to two days. Just be mindful that the croissants might lose a little crispness, but reheating can bring them back to life.

Freezing

You can freeze the cooked patties separately for up to 3 months by placing them on a baking sheet to freeze individually before transferring to a freezer-safe bag. For the croissants and assembled burgers, freezing isn’t ideal since the flaky texture and condiments may be compromised when thawed.

Reheating

To bring your leftovers back to that fresh, crispy glory, reheat croissant buns and patties separately. Toast the croissants lightly in a skillet or oven, and warm the patties quickly in a pan over medium heat. Avoid microwaving as it tends to soften and soggy both the bread and meat.

FAQs

Can I use another type of bread instead of croissants?

Absolutely! While croissants give this recipe its signature flakiness and buttery taste, you can substitute brioche buns or potato rolls for a softer, sweeter alternative. Just keep in mind the unique texture croissants bring to the smash burger experience.

What’s the best type of cheese for these burgers?

Cheddar, Swiss, or American cheese melt beautifully on these patties. If you want a bit of extra flavor, try pepper jack or gruyere. Choose what you love because the cheese really ties the whole burger together!

How do I prevent the patties from sticking to the pan?

Make sure your skillet is hot before adding the beef balls. Using a cast iron pan also helps with even heat distribution and prevents sticking. Additionally, avoid moving the patties too soon—let them form a crust first, then flip carefully.

Can I add toppings like bacon or avocado?

Definitely! Crispy bacon pairs wonderfully with the buttery croissant and juicy beef, and ripe avocado adds creaminess and freshness. Feel free to customize your burger to suit your taste buds perfectly.

Is this recipe suitable for weeknight dinners?

Yes, it’s perfect for quick weeknight meals because it comes together in about 25 minutes with minimal fuss. The simple 5-step process makes it approachable even on busy days, delivering big flavor quickly.

Ingredients

Scale

For the Patties

  • 1 pound Ground Beef (80/20) (for juicy and flavorful patties)
  • 1 teaspoon Salt (to enhance flavors)
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per (freshly ground black)

For the Croissants and Assembly

  • 4 Croissants (flaky and multi-layered)
  • 2 tablespoons Butter (for toasting)
  • 1 cup Lettuce (for crunch)
  • 1 medium Tomato (sliced)
  • 4 slices Cheese (your favorite type)
  • To taste Condiments (ketchup, mustard, or aioli)


Instructions

  1. Prep the Croissants: Preheat your skillet over medium heat for 5 minutes. Cut each croissant in half horizontally, then spread butter generously on the cut sides to prepare them for toasting.
  2. Form the Patties: Divide the ground beef into four equal portions (about 1/4 pound each). Shape each into a rough ball without overworking the meat to keep patties tender and juicy.
  3. Cook the Patties: Place the beef balls in the hot skillet. Using a spatula, firmly smash each ball down into a thin patty. Cook the patties undisturbed for about 3 minutes to develop a crispy crust, then flip and cook the other side for another 3 minutes until browned and cooked through.
  4. Toast the Croissants: While the patties are finishing, place the buttered croissant halves cut side down in the skillet and toast until golden brown and crispy, about 1-2 minutes.
  5. Assemble and Serve: Allow the patties to rest briefly off the heat. Place each patty on the bottom toasted croissant half, top with a slice of cheese so it melts slightly. Add lettuce, tomato slices, and condiments of your choice. Cover with the top croissant half and serve immediately while warm and bursting with flavor.

Notes

  • Do not overwork the ground beef when forming patties to maintain juiciness.
  • Use an 80/20 beef blend for the best balance of flavor and moisture.
  • Butter the croissants generously to achieve a rich, crispy toast.
  • Feel free to customize toppings and condiments to your preference.
  • Serve immediately for the best texture and taste.
